Matching your nails and toes is a simple yet impactful way to refresh your overall style and boost your confidence. From my experience, choosing a cohesive color like soft pink instantly elevates the look, making it feel polished and put-together. Adding subtle bling accents or tiny rhinestones can bring that extra sparkle without overwhelming the design, perfect for those looking to add a personalized touch. If you’re new to nail art, starting with a matching mani-pedi set is a fantastic beginner-friendly project. It allows you to get comfortable with the basics of polish application and experimenting with textures or finishes. Additionally, doing them yourself saves money while providing the satisfaction of a self-made beauty upgrade. When selecting products, opt for long-lasting, chip-resistant polish and consider investing in a good top coat to maintain that fresh salon look. Taking care of your nails before painting—like trimming, filing, and moisturizing cuticles—ensures the best results and healthier nails.
